Bridge to Home homeless shelter

Tax deductible
An El Nino winter means the homeless shelter will be opening 3 weeks early and will most likely stay open approximately 30 days longer, based on our last El Nino. This means we'll need to raise funds to cover the additional costs to provide a warm, safe place for our neighbors experiencing homelessness.  Will you help Bridge to Home ensure we will have the ability to keep our doors open longer during this challenging winter season?
